Hyderabad, 27th  March 2025 – TTK Prestige, a household name in innovative kitchen appliances, proudly introduces its latest Digi Kettle Range, designed to redefine the way you brew tea, coffee, and instant meals. Packed with smart technology, modern aesthetics, and advanced safety features, this new collection ensures precision heating, effortless usability, and maximum convenience.

The Prestige Digi Kettle 2.0L stands out with its Live Temperature Display, which allows users to monitor heating in real time. Equipped with four preset temperature modes and a Keep Warm function, it guarantees the perfect brew every time. The 360° Swivel Base ensures easy, cordless pouring from any angle, enhancing ease of use. Designed with safety in mind, it features Automatic Power Cut-Off to prevent overheating and Dry Heat Protection to avoid operation without water. The stainless steel inner body ensures durability and purity, while the single-touch lid locking system adds an extra layer of convenience.

Expanding its range, TTK Prestige also introduces the Prestige Glass Kettle 1.8L and the Prestige Cool Touch Kettle 1.5L, catering to diverse consumer needs. The Prestige Glass Kettle 1.8L seamlessly blends style and functionality with its sleek glass body, blue LED indicator, and metallic rose gold finish. Designed for enhanced safety and efficiency, it features Auto Cut-Off, Dry Heat Protection, and a Concealed Heating Element. The Prestige Cool Touch Kettle 1.5L, available in black and white, is a stylish and secure choice with a cool-touch exterior that makes it safe to handle even while boiling. It is equipped with Auto Cut-Off, Dry Heat Protection, and a concealed heating element, ensuring a seamless and worry-free experience.

The Prestige Digi Kettle Range is now available at leading retail stores and online platforms across India. The Prestige Glass Kettle 1.8L is priced at an MRP of ?1,860, with a market operating price of ?1,395. The Prestige Cool Touch Kettle 1.5L is available at an MRP of ?1,725, with a market price of ?1,295. About TTK Prestige (https://shop.ttkprestige.com/) 

TTK Prestige Limited is part of TTK Group. Over the past six decades TTK Prestige Limited, has emerged as India’s largest kitchen appliances company catering to the needs of homemakers in the country. Every Prestige brand product is built on the pillars of safety, innovation, durability and trust, making the brand the first choice in millions of homes. In April 2016, TTK Prestige bought UK based Horwood Homewares and launched Judge Brand in India in August 2017.
